Flame Retardant Treatment
A compliance deadline, not a hygiene inconvenience
Commercial vessels under 500 tons registered under a Red Ensign Group (REG) flag — UK, Isle of Man, Cayman Islands, BVI, and others — must renew flame retardant treatment certification every 2 years to maintain class. Missing this isn't a hygiene inconvenience — it's a compliance failure that can affect a vessel's certification status.

A closed environment that contaminates fast
A yacht's interior is a closed environment — humidity, salt air, and constant guest turnover accelerate the same contamination that takes months to build up in a house. For chartered vessels, crew accommodation hygiene also falls under scrutiny during MLC 2006 (Maritime Labour Convention) welfare inspections and charter guest expectations alike.
